What companies run services between Meriden, CT, USA and Danbury, CT, USA?

You can take a train from Meriden to Danbury via New Haven and South Norwalk in around 3h 38m. Alternatively, you can take a bus from State St @ Meriden RR Station to Pulse Point via Temple St @ New Haven Green, Temple St @ Chapel St, Westfield Connecticut Post Mall, and Norwalk Wheels Hub in around 6h 21m.
